2017-03516 Allied Safe Corporation, also known as Napoli Allied Safe, appellant, v Peter Pekich, doing business as Medcor Holding Co., respondent. (Index No. 7061/16)
| D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ION |
Motion by the appellant to stay its eviction from the subject premises, pending hearing and determination of an appeal from an order of the Supreme Court, Nassau County, entered March 2, 2017.
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and the papers filed in opposition thereto, it is
ORDERED that the motion is denied.
